Cross-Cultural Communities of Practice for College Readiness
Leonard, Jack
Teacher Development, v18 n4 p511-529 2014
College readiness is a social construct requiring both student and adult preparedness. This paper used a case study methodology to explore how teaching in an early college program might promote adult college readiness in the instructors. A community of practice, enhanced by a co-teaching model, in two separate high school settings under one early college program, was the unit of analysis. The communities of practice provided a safe place for risk-taking, experimentation and innovation. Semi-structured interviews revealed growth in cross-cultural understanding, content knowledge and contextual skills and knowledge as well as general teaching skills, all of which would contribute to student success in the secondary/postsecondary transition. Self-discovery and self-expression flourished, but concrete changes in identity were minimal and institutional learning was marginal.
